    Vanquish Motor and esc question

    I am planning to install this outrunner

    http://www.hobbyking.com/hobbyking/s...dProduct=26502

    and a Seaking 180 amp esc in a hobbyking vanquish on 2 5000mah 40c turnigys wired in series for 4s

    where would be a good place to start with a prop? I am only looking for a 30-35 mph sport boat

    That outrunner is a mere 1600 watts for a 40" hull?
    Not going to go fast and it will heat up some. You would be much better off with the red helicopter motors they sell for a boat.

    I understand you only want 30-35 but, you could do it with allot less heat with the red Heli motors like this:

    http://www.hobbyking.com/hobbyking/s...ass_Heli_.html

    On 4S it would run well on 1P. Start with a 42mm prop.

    What would really move out nice on 6S is the 1330Kv version.

    They also have an 1800'ish kv version.
